
Dairy-Free French Onion Soup
A classic French onion soup made without dairy, featuring deeply caramelized onions in a rich broth, topped with toasted baguette slices.
Ingredients
- 3 lbs Yellow onions, thinly sliced
- 2 tbsp Olive oil
- 8 cups Vegetable broth
- 1 cup Dry red wine (optional)
- 1 leaf Bay leaf
- 2 sprigs Thyme sprigs
- 1 tsp Salt
- 1/2 tsp Black pepper
- 8 slices Baguette slices
- 1/4 cup Dairy-free parmesan alternative, shredded (optional)
Instructions
- 1Place a large pot or Dutch oven on the stove. Add the 2 tbsp of olive oil and heat it over medium heat (approximately 300-325°F / 150-160°C) for 1 minute. Add the 3 lbs of thinly sliced yellow onions to the pot and cook, stirring frequently, for 30-40 minutes, until the onions are deeply golden brown, very soft, and have a sweet, rich aroma.
- 2Carefully pour the 8 cups of vegetable broth and, if you are using it, the 1 cup of dry red wine into the pot with the caramelized onions. Add the 1 bay leaf and the 2 thyme sprigs. Increase the heat to medium-high (approximately 350-375°F / 175-190°C) and b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, where small bubbles consistently break the surface. Once simmering, reduce the heat to low (approximately 175-200°F / 80-95°C) and let it simmer gently for 15 minutes. The soup will become fragrant, and the flavors will meld together.
- 3Remove the 1 bay leaf and the 2 thyme sprigs from the soup. Stir in the 1 tsp of salt and the 1/2 tsp of black pepper. While the soup is still warm, preheat your oven broiler to its highest setting (approximately 500-550°F / 260-290°C). Place the 8 slices of baguette on a baking sheet.
- 4Carefully place the baking sheet with the 8 baguette slices under the preheated broiler. Broil for 1-3 minutes, watching constantly, until the baguette slices are lightly golden brown and crisp. Remove the baking sheet from the oven.
- 5Carefully ladle the hot soup into four individual oven-safe bowls. Place two toasted baguette slices on top of the soup in each bowl. If you are using it, sprinkle the 1/4 cup of shredded dairy-free parmesan alternative evenly over the baguette slices in each bowl. Carefully place the bowls under the preheated broiler for 1-2 minutes, watching closely, until the dairy-free parmesan alternative is melted and bubbly.
